Who We Are: Atlas Energy Solutions Inc. (NYSE: AESI) is a leading solutions provider to the energy industry. Atlas’ portfolio of offerings includes oilfield logistics, distributed power systems, and the largest proppant supply network in the Permian Basin. With a focus on leveraging technology, automation, and remote operations to enhance efficiencies, Atlas is centered around a core mission of improving human beings’ access to hydrocarbons that power our lives and, by doing so, maximizing value creation for our shareholders. How You Will Make an Impact: The Dune Express Roller crew will be responsible for changing rollers which fail on the conveyor system in a timely and efficient manner Duties and Responsibilities: • Gathers technical information to perform the job. • Performs equipment walk around and inspects and adjusts equipment; properly disposes of wastes. • Understanding of MSHA and OSHA standards and able to follow in accordance with while performing daily functions of the job. • Able to safely isolate equipment to perform repairs and maintenance, work at heights and in adverse weather conditions. • Checks the status of equipment availability with site supervisors, and follows procedures to pick up parts and supplies from the warehouse. • Be willing to learn the procedures of changing rollers with the roller changing tool which is provided and make quick responsive repairs without guidance. • Performs work order repairs on the conveyor system as directed by the Conveyor Supervisor • Coordinates and plans down time efficiently to maximize uptime of production. • Work with conveyor mechanics and create a working relationship with other employees on the Dune Express • To accomplish this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form, with or without reasonable accommodation, the essential functions or the employment related responsibilities of the job. • All other duties as assigned Qualifications: • Education: High School Diploma or GED required.. • Experience: None required • Computer Skills: Basic computer skills required use of an I-pad Certifications& Licenses: • A valid state driver's license with no active violations within the previous year.
